Transaction 746edfe3fcdd7dc801642d206d5847ad1585ca63ddcc059768dba2afade9e200

1 Input
1 Outputs
  • 746edfe3fcdd7dc801642d206d5847ad1585ca63ddcc059768dba2afade9e200:0
  • value  1956109
    address  39CjWWivUU1AfgF6M39CPXeXcx4g7o2uyA